In accordance with our [security policy for `libcrux`](https://github.com/cryspen/libcrux/blob/main/SECURITY.md), we publish a GitHub security advisory for any releases whose CHANGELOG includes bug-fixes, and encourage our users to upgrade. The latest releases of the `libcrux-ecdh`, `libcrux-ed25519` and `libcrux-psq` crates contain the following bug-fixes: ## `libcrux-ecdh` - [#1301](https://github.com/cryspen/libcrux/pull/1301): Check length and clamping in X25519 secret validation. This is a breaking change since errors are now raised on unclamped X25519 secrets or inputs of the wrong length ## `libcrux-ed25519` - [#1320](https://github.com/cryspen/libcrux/pull/1320): Remove duplicated clamping step during key generation The issue fixed in #1320 was first reported by Nadim Kobeissi. ## `libcrux-psq` - [#1319](https://github.com/cryspen/libcrux/pull/1319): Propagate AEADError instead of panicking - [#1301](https://github.com/cryspen/libcrux/pull/1301): Fix broken clamping check for imported X25519 secret keys The issue fixed in #1319 was first reported by Nadim Kobeissi.
